在处理科学、工程或数学数据时,我们经常会遇到弧度与度分秒之间的转换。弧度是角度的一种表示方式,主要用于数学和物理领域,而度分秒则是日常生活中更常见的角度表示方法。下面,我将为你详细介绍如何轻松地将表格中的弧度值转换为度分秒。
什么是弧度和度分秒?
弧度
弧度是角度的单位,定义为圆的半径所对应的圆心角。在数学和物理中,弧度是一个常用的角度单位。一个完整的圆对应360度,也对应2π弧度。
度分秒
度分秒是另一种角度单位,1度等于60分,1分等于60秒。这种单位在日常生活中更为常见,尤其是在地理学和天文学中。
弧度转度分秒的公式
要将弧度转换为度分秒,我们可以使用以下公式:
- 将弧度值乘以180/π,得到角度的度数部分。
- 将度数部分的余数乘以60,得到分。
- 将分部分的余数乘以60,得到秒。
实例说明
假设我们有一个表格,其中包含以下弧度值:
| 弧度值 | 度分秒 |
|---|---|
| 1.5708 | |
| 2.3562 | |
| 3.1416 |
下面,我们将使用上述公式将这些弧度值转换为度分秒。
第一步:将弧度值转换为度数
对于1.5708,我们有:
1.5708 × (180/π) ≈ 90.0因此,1.5708弧度等于90度。
对于2.3562,我们有:
2.3562 × (180/π) ≈ 135.0因此,2.3562弧度等于135度。
对于3.1416,我们有:
3.1416 × (180/π) ≈ 180.0因此,3.1416弧度等于180度。
第二步:将度数转换为度分秒
对于90度,没有余数,因此:
90度 = 90° 0' 0"对于135度,我们有:
135度 = 135° 0' 0"对于180度,没有余数,因此:
180度 = 180° 0' 0"
使用编程语言转换弧度值
如果你需要批量转换弧度值,可以使用编程语言,如Python,来简化这个过程。以下是一个使用Python将弧度值转换为度分秒的示例代码:
import math
def radians_to_dms(radians):
degrees = math.degrees(radians)
minutes = int((degrees - int(degrees)) * 60)
seconds = int(((degrees - int(degrees)) * 60 - minutes) * 60)
return degrees, minutes, seconds
# 示例
radians = 1.5708
degrees, minutes, seconds = radians_to_dms(radians)
print(f"{radians}弧度等于{degrees}° {minutes}' {seconds}\"")
通过以上方法,你可以轻松地将表格中的弧度值转换为度分秒。希望这篇文章能帮助你更好地理解和处理角度单位之间的转换。
